ChronicleName Element for SubscriptionClass/Chronicles/Chronicle (ADF)

Specifies the user-defined name of the subscription chronicle table.

Element Characteristics

Characteristic Description

Data type

string, between 1 and 255 characters in length.

Default value

None.

Occurrence

Required once per Chronicle element.

Updates

Can be modified, but not added or deleted, when updating an application.

Notes

The ChronicleName value should be the same as the chronicle table name as defined in the related SqlSchema element.

ms145364.note(fr-fr,SQL.90).gifImportant :
If you update the ChronicleName value, updating the application re-creates the subscription class to which it corresponds. SQL Server 2005 Notification Services renames existing subscription tables by appending "Old" to the name and then creates new subscription tables. Existing subscription table indexes remain unchanged. If you want to transfer data between the old and new subscription tables, it must be done manually. Exemple

The following example shows a populated ChronicleName element.

<ChronicleName>StockSubscriptionChron</ChronicleName>
